Transaction 3283650e16410e151b79d9997e790c18c7f1bd058758c1ff4040e934f9cbaf57
1 Input
1 Output
-
3283650e16410e151b79d9997e790c18c7f1bd058758c1ff4040e934f9cbaf57:0
- value
- 1300082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d6f3e0f31de771d8544e04e18bc83078364d85e OP_EQUAL
- address
- 3MsrXCPDcAQLpCzCVJWFzt1ubMTuuSVi6b